                               Myths and heroes

 

 First of all I would like to give a definition of this notion : A myth can be defined as a story about gods or heroes, it can be a popular belief or a tradition or a false notion. A hero can be a mythological figure, a person who is admired for his or her achievements, a superhero or maybe a role model or an icon.

   One day Narcissus was walking in the woods when Echo saw him, fell deeply in love, and followed him. Narcissus sensed he was being followed and shouted "Who's there?". Echo repeated "Who's there?" She eventually revealed her identity and attempted to embrace him. He stepped away and told her to leave him alone. She was heartbroken and spent the rest of her life in lonely glens until nothing but an echo sound remained of her. Nemesis,the goddess of revenge, noticed this behaviour after learning the story and decided to punish Narcissus. Once, during the summer, , and the goddess lead him to a pool where he saw his reflection in the water. Narcissus did not realize it was merely his own reflection and fell deeply in love with it, as if it was somebody else. When he realized that it was only his own reflection and that his love could not be reciprocated, he comitted a suicide.

Mamadou Gassama is a malian naturalized french who became  famous after climbing on May 26, 2018, four floors of a Parisian building to save a four-year-old child clinging to a balcony.

Mamadou risked his life to save a stranger and this act can be defined as an heroic act.
